Sumario:The World Biosphere Reserve Parque Atlántico Mar Chiquito is the only micromareal lagoon in Argentina and the southernmost in South America. The objective of this study is to model the environmental vulnerability of the hydrological basin under different land use changes. The model can provide information to prevent flood events, pollution and other hazards, as well as constituting a contribution to integrated land planning and management. We estimated the Runoff Curve Number for each hydrologic soil-cover complex under seven land-use scenarios, considering agronomic activities and urban growth. The results showed that the waterlogging vulnerability increased under the selected scenarios, strongly associated with the soil types present in the district but also due to the land uses and their impacts in well-structured, well-drained soils. © 2019 Elsevier Ltd
